Cinderella's Triumph in the French Open Ruins

Extending the clay-court chaos tracked last week, the bracket-clearing upsets at Roland Garros have culminated in a historic, low-ranked qualifier seizing a spot in the women's singles final [The Guardian].

"Chwalinska is the first qualifier in history to reach the French Open final and just the second to reach the final of any grand slam after Emma Raducanu at the 2021 US Open."Polish Qualifier Maja Chwalińska Makes Historic Run to 2026 French Open Finalreuters.com

"Chwalińska's fairy-tale run is one of the most unexpected in tennis history."Polish Qualifier Maja Chwalińska Makes Historic Run to 2026 French Open Finalreuters.com

Chwalińska's fairy-tale run, which required financial backing from Polish beverage brand Oshee to cover her Paris hotel bills, sets up a final against teenage Russian sensation Mirra Andreeva [The Guardian]. Her craftiness completely disrupted Diana Shnaider's power, proving that tactical variation can dismantle the heavy-hitting styles dominating modern tennis [The Guardian].

What to watch: Watch whether Chwalińska's crafty playstyle can overcome Andreeva's composed baseline game in Saturday's historic final.

Darkening Clouds Over the Yankees' Franchise Star

Following up on the team's initial rib cage diagnostics last week, what was first downplayed as a nagging bone bruise has escalated into a potential season-altering medical crisis for Aaron Judge [USA Today].

"Thoracic outlet syndrome is an injury involving compressed nerves or blood vessels between the neck and shoulder that has historically derailed or ended major sports careers."Yankees Await Aaron Judge Diagnosis as Thoracic Outlet Specialist Reviews Testsfrontofficesports.comespn.com

"...we’re waiting on the specialist to weigh in. That’s where we’re at. … It’s a lot of smart people in a specialized area, and guys several states away. Just got to be patient."Yankees Await Aaron Judge Diagnosis as Thoracic Outlet Specialist Reviews Testsfrontofficesports.comespn.com

By seeking consultation from Dallas-based thoracic outlet syndrome specialist Dr. Gregory Pearl, the Yankees are confronting a diagnosis that could alter their entire competitive trajectory [USA Today]. The team's decision to delay an Injured List move reveals their anxiety and reluctance to lose their captain for an extended period while swelling prevents a clear imaging read [NY Post].

What to watch: Watch for Dr. Pearl's official diagnosis, which will determine if Judge faces a standard recovery or a highly complex vascular intervention.

Brazil's High-Stakes World Cup Rehabilitation Gamble

Building on the tactical roster gamble noted last week, Brazil is doubling down by isolating Neymar from pre-tournament exhibitions to focus entirely on his physical rehabilitation [World Soccer Talk].

"With Brazil facing Egypt on Saturday, Neymar will miss the trip for the friendly to continue his recovery ahead of the 2026 World Cup."Neymar Sidelined for Egypt Friendly as World Cup Recovery Continuesenglish.aawsat.combbc.comfoxsports.com

"Despite the injury, coach Carlo Ancelotti remains optimistic about Neymar's availability for the tournament..."Neymar Sidelined for Egypt Friendly as World Cup Recovery Continuesenglish.aawsat.combbc.comfoxsports.com

Leaving the forward behind in New Jersey while the rest of the squad travels to Cleveland for their final exhibition match shows how carefully Brazil is managing Neymar's recovery from a calf tear [Sportstar]. Coach Carlo Ancelotti's relaxed approach underscores a belief that having a healthy Neymar for the tournament's opening matches is worth sacrificing his participation in crucial warm-up fixtures [Sportstar].

What to watch: Watch whether Neymar's specialized rehabilitation in New Jersey allows him to join team training in time for Brazil's opening World Cup match.
